Synchronoss Technologies Inc (NASDAQ:SNCR) announced it has been added to the US small-cap Russell 2000 Index as part of the 2025 annual reconstitution of Russell indexes.
The company’s inclusion will take effect after markets open on June 30 and will remain in place for one year.
Synchronoss was also automatically added to the appropriate growth and value indexes, the company said in a statement.

Russell indexes are widely tracked by investment managers and institutional investors, with approximately $10.6 trillion in assets benchmarked against the Russell US indexes as of June 2024, according to FTSE Russell.
The annual reconstitution of the Russell indexes ranks US stocks by market capitalization and reassigns them to the appropriate indexes to ensure accurate representation of the marketplace.
